About the adventure
Planegea is a world before metal, before writing, before kingdoms. Tribes wander vast wildernesses shaped by primordial forces. Dinosaurs and megafauna dominate the land. Spirits are real and active. The gods are distant and alien. Sometimes even speaking certain truths can invite divine punishment. There is no steel. No cities. No permanent empires. Only survival, reputation, and belief. In this campaign, you begin as members of a wandering tribe navigating a brutal, beautiful world. You will cross mammoth-haunted tundras, primordial jungles, volcanic wastes, and spirit-touched wilds. You will encounter rival tribes, ancient ruins from lost ages, monstrous predators, and cosmic omens written in the stars. But this is not just a survival story. Over time, your tribe will change because of you. Your decisions will shape traditions. Your victories and failures will define taboos. Your alliances may determine whether your people continue to wander… or choose to plant roots. The long-term arc of this campaign is cultural creation. You are not inheriting a kingdom. You are building the first version of one. Expect: • Tribal politics and evolving leadership • Spiritual bargains and dangerous magic • Resource scarcity and meaningful travel • Reputation systems that matter • A slow-burning cosmic mystery tied to the Star-Shaman’s Song If you want to carve your people’s story into the bones of the world and one day look back and say, “This is where our culture began,” then this is your table.

About me
I am a former award-winning stage actor, writer, and director who has been playing Dungeons & Dragons since 1998 and GMing since 2001. Over the years I’ve run Advanced D&D 2nd Edition, 3.0/3.5, GURPS, Star Wars, Rifts, Vampire, Marvel Multiverse, DC Universe, Wheel of Time, and many many more, before finding my home again in 5th Edition. At the table, I specialize in immersive storytelling, cinematic voice acting, and character-driven narratives. I create living worlds filled with complex NPCs where player choices matter — shaping the story and weaving backstories into a larger campaign arc. My goal is to give players the chance to grow their characters into legends in ways that feel personal and memorable. When I’m not running games, I stream on YouTube and Twitch or gather my family around the table to share the joy of roleplay.

Safety
How The Chaos Shaman creates a safe table
At any point before, during or after a game, any player can contact me and request I change the material. We can discuss this in private or as a group. A simple "X" in a private message during a game will cause a scene change. Safety and content will be discussed during the free session zero.
